Build a new Bitcoin Transaction.
List of transaction inputs.
Is this a coin base transaction?
Returns true if the transaction itself opted in to be BIP-125-replaceable (RBF). This does not cover the case where a transaction becomes replaceable due to ancestors being RBF.
Returns true if this transactions nLockTime is enabled (BIP-65).
Block height or timestamp. Transaction cannot be included in a block until this height/time. Relevant BIPs BIP-65 OP_CHECKLOCKTIMEVERIFY BIP-113 Median time-past as endpoint for lock-time calculations
List of transaction outputs.
Return the transaction bytes, bitcoin consensus encoded.
Returns the regular byte-wise consensus-serialized size of this transaction.
The protocol version, is currently expected to be 1 or 2 (BIP 68).
Returns the "virtual size" (vsize) of this transaction.
Returns the "weight" of this transaction, as defined by BIP141.